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to structural instability caused by foundation cracks. These repairs typically include techniques such as epoxy injection to seal minor cracks, underpinning to strengthen the foundation, and the installation of pier systems to stabilize and lift the foundation when necessary. The goal is to restore the integrity of the foundation,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the safety and stability of the property. Professionals evaluate the extent of the damage and recommend the most appropriate repair methods based on the specific conditions of each property.
Cracks in a foundation can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ed. These may include uneven flooring, sticking doors and windows, or more severe structural concerns like shifting walls or sinking slabs. Water infiltration through cracks can also cause interior damage and mold growth. Repairing these cracks helps mitigate ongoing issues, preserving the property's value and preventing costly future repairs. Foundation repair services are applicable to a wide range of properties,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Older properties often experience foundation issues due to settling or soil movement, while new constructions may develop cracks from construction-related factors or soil conditions. Different types of foundations, such as basement, crawl space, or slab-on-grade, may require tailored repair approaches. Cost of Foundation Repair - Typical expenses range from $2,000 to $8,000 depending on the extent of the damage and repair method. For example, minor cracks may cost around $2,000, while extensive underpinning can reach $8,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Price - The total cost varies based on foundation type, soil conditions, and accessibility. In Morton, IL, repairs can fluctuate significantly, with some projects costing over $10,000 for complex cases.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Foundation repair services often charge between $5 and $15 per square foot. Larger or more complicated repairs t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Additional Expenses - Costs may include soil stabilization, drainage improvements, or waterproofing,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ific foundation issues.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, foundation underpinning, or wall stabilization, depending on the severity and type of crack.
Is foundation repair necessary for all types of cracks? Not all cracks require repair; hairline or minor cracks may be cosmetic, but larger or active cracks often indicate structural issues needing assessment.
How long does foundation crack rep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days by local service providers.
